AutoLander.ai

AutoLander is a desktop application that helps car dealerships automate Facebook Marketplace listings with AI-powered descriptions, inventory synchronization, photo enhancement, listing updates, and automated posting.

What makes your product unique?

AutoLander.ai's answer

AutoLander is a native desktop application built specifically for car dealerships to automate Facebook Marketplace listing management. It combines inventory synchronization, AI-generated vehicle descriptions, AI-powered photo enhancement, walkaround video generation, automated posting, listing updates, and sold vehicle removal in a single platform. Team plans also include a live Manager Dashboard for monitoring posting activity across multiple users.

What's the story behind your product?

AutoLander.ai's answer

AutoLander was created to simplify the repetitive process of managing vehicle listings on Facebook Marketplace. Many dealerships spend significant time creating listings, updating prices, and removing sold inventory. AutoLander was developed to automate these tasks using AI-powered tools and inventory synchronization, allowing dealership teams to manage Marketplace listings more efficiently while keeping inventory up to date.
